About the Role

This position supports Cincinnati Children's mission by ensuring timely and accurate patient access to healthcare services. The Patient Access Representative serves as the first point of contact for patients and families, facilitating registration, scheduling, and financial clearance.

Responsibilities

  • Greet patients and families in a professional, compassionate manner.
  • Verify patient demographic, insurance, and financial information accurately.
  • Schedule appointments, procedures, and tests using electronic systems.
  • Collect co-pays, deductibles, and outstanding balances at time of service.
  • Explain financial policies, payment plans, and insurance requirements to patients.
  • Collaborate with clinical teams, billing departments, and insurance providers to resolve discrepancies.
  • Maintain confidentiality and comply with HIPAA regulations.
  • Assist with patient flow and escalate urgent needs to appropriate staff.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; associate degree or relevant certification (e.g., CHAA, CMAA) preferred.
  • Minimum 1 year of experience in healthcare registration, scheduling, or customer service.
  • Proficiency with electronic health records (EHR) and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Strong commun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with frequent interruptions.
  • Knowledge of medical terminology and insurance processes is a plus.
